The 8th Costume Designers Guild Awards, given on February 25, 2006, honored the best costume designs in film and television for 2005. The nominees were announced on January 11, 2006.{{cite web|url=https://variety.com/2006/film/awards/costume-guild-reveals-noms-1117935957/|title=Costume Guild reveals noms|work=Variety|author=Variety Staff|date=January 11, 2006|accessdate=August 22, 2022}}
